You may notice how a spayed dog's mammary glands, nipples, and vulva are smaller compared to those of intact, non … csr soundscreen acoustic battsWebSpaying is the common term used to describe the surgical procedure known as an ovariohysterectomy. In this procedure, the ovaries and uterus are removed completely in order to sterilize a female dog. Some veterinarians are now performing an ovariectomy where only the ovaries are removed. csr sound insulationWeb14 de jan. de 2024 · Check your dog's secondary sexual traits. 3.
